The 2022 Individual High School State Tournaments Hub


 Pictured: The Giant Center in Hershey, Pennsylvania. The Giant Center is home to the Pennsylvania (PIAA) Class-2A and Class-3A State Tournaments. 

What a busy weekend of wrestling it was!

On the high school scene, it was the second weekend of individual high school state tournaments. This weekend (Feb. 17-19) was the busiest one yet! With that, north of 20 different states brought their respective boys high school seasons to a close. At this juncture, nearly 25 total states have officially concluded the 2021-22 boys high school wrestling season. All others states will be finishing their seasons over the next few weeks.

On the Division I circuit, this weekend (Feb. 18-20) was the last full weekend of regular-season competition. At this point, virtually all of Division I is off until the first weekend in March (March 5-6), when all seven conferences host their postseason tournaments before NCAAs in Detroit, Michigan, March 17-19.
